KRS 77.085: Election of chairman and vice chairman -- Secretary-treasurer and air

pollution control officer -- Deputies, assistants, and other employees.

(1) An air pollution control board operating under KRS 77.070 shall, in July of each

year, elect from its me mbers a chairman and a vice chairman who shall be of

different political party affiliation. The board shall employ a competent secretary -

treasurer and an air pollution control officer, neither of whom shall be a member of

the board. The secretary -treasurer and the air pollution control officer shall devote

their entire time and attention exclusively to the services of the board.

(2) The air pollution control officer shall be an engineer by profession and shall be a

graduate of a recognized university or col lege, shall be thoroughly familiar with the

theory and practice of the prevention and control of air pollution, and shall meet the

qualifications for a nonelective peace officer stated in KRS 61.300.

(3) The secretary-treasurer and the air pollution contro l officer may be removed by the

board, for cause, after hearing by it and after at least ten (10) days notice in writing

shall have been given to the secretary -treasurer or the air pollution control officer,

as the case may be, which notice shall embrace t he charges preferred against the

person. At the hearing the person may be represented by counsel. The finding of the

board shall be final.

(4) The board may provide for assistants, deputies, clerks, attaches, and other persons

to be employed by the secreta ry-treasurer and the air pollution control officer, and

the times at which they shall be appointed.
